About the Library

The library is open from 8:10 AM till 3:15 PM, Monday through Friday. Students are welcome to use the library and its resources at any time during the day provided they have an authorized pass from a teacher during class time. The student must sign in when entering the library and sign out upon leaving. A pass and signing in/out is not necessary during breaks and lunches. The library is also used for make-up testing during many class periods, therefore the library will be monitored accordingly. All students are required to pay a fee of ten cents per page for any printed or copied material. Most library books may be checked out for a three-week period. There is a late fee of ten cents per day thereafter. There are 16 computer stations provided in the library with full internet access with firewalls for student use. Computer are intended for academic purposes only. E-mailing, Facebook, chat rooms, etc. are not allowed. The library is also a "NO FOOD OR DRINK ZONE."
